Job Description:

The Quality Assurance Specialist will play a critical role in maintaining and enhancing the quality assurance system within the company. You will work closely with other departments to ensure that products meet the highest standards of quality, safety, and compliance.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ee and manage the day-to-day activities of the quality assurance system,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ements (e.g., GMP, ISO standards).
  • Perform internal audits to ensure adherence to company policies, procedures, and quality standards.
  • Review and approve batch records, manufacturing instructions, and other technical documentation to ensure accuracy and compliance.
  • Lead investigations and provide corrective and preventive actions (CAPA) for quality deviations, complaints, and non-conformances.
  • Collaborate with production and other departments to ensure all products meet specified quality standards.
Required Skills and Qualifications:

To be successful in this role, you will need:

  • A Bachelor's degree in Chemistry, Pharmaceutical Sciences, Life Sciences, or a related field.
  • A minimum of 2-3 years of experience in a quality assurance role within the pharmaceutical or chemical manufacturing industry.
  • Strong understanding of regulatory guidelines such as GMP, ISO, and ICH.
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to liaise effectively with cross-functional teams and regulatory bodies.
